Legal Framework Governing Data Security in Banking

The legal framework governing data security in banking is primarily formed by a combination of international standards, national laws, and regulatory guidelines. These legal provisions aim to protect sensitive customer information and ensure the integrity of banking operations.

At the international level, frameworks like the General Data Protection Regulation (GDPR) in the European Union establish stringent data privacy and security requirements applicable to banking institutions operating within or connected to the EU. Many countries also implement specific banking laws that mandate data protection measures, incident reporting, and breach notification procedures.

National regulators and financial authorities often develop sector-specific regulations to enforce data security standards within the banking industry. These regulations typically prescribe cybersecurity protocols, data encryption practices, and risk management strategies. Compliance with such frameworks is vital for legal operation and maintaining customer trust.

Overall, the legal framework governing data security in banking continually evolves to address emerging threats and technological advancements, making it an essential aspect of banking law and regulation.

Cyberattacks and Phishing Scams

Cyberattacks and phishing scams pose significant threats to the security of banking data. Cybercriminals employ various techniques to access sensitive information unlawfully. Understanding these methods is essential for implementing effective defense strategies.

Cyberattacks can include methods such as hacking into banking systems, Distributed Denial of Service (DDoS) attacks, or exploiting vulnerabilities in banking software. These attacks aim to disrupt services or steal confidential customer data.

Phishing scams specifically target bank customers and employees through deceptive emails, messages, or websites. These scams often mimic legitimate banking communications to trick individuals into revealing login credentials or personal information. Common signs include urgent language, unfamiliar URLs, or unexpected requests.

To combat these threats, banks must stay vigilant by monitoring for suspicious activities and educating customers on recognizing phishing attempts. Implementing multi-factor authentication and secure communication protocols are vital measures to enhance data security in banking.

Malware and Ransomware Incidents

Malware and ransomware incidents pose significant threats to banking data security by exploiting vulnerabilities within banking systems. Malware, malicious software designed to infiltrate or damage systems, can lead to data breaches, unauthorized access, or theft of sensitive customer information.

Ransomware, a specific type of malware, encrypts banking data and demands payment for its decryption, often crippling banking operations temporarily. Such incidents not only compromise data integrity but also undermine customer trust and violate banking laws governing data protection.

Cybercriminals often deploy ransomware through phishing emails or malicious links, leveraging social engineering tactics. Banks must implement rigorous cybersecurity measures to detect and prevent these attacks, ensuring compliance with legal frameworks. Maintaining vigilant security protocols is critical to mitigate risks associated with malware and ransomware incidents, thereby safeguarding banking data.

Insider Threats and Fraudulent Activities

Insider threats and fraudulent activities pose significant risks to data security in banking, often involving employees or trusted personnel exploiting their access to sensitive information. These insiders may intentionally or unintentionally compromise data integrity, leading to severe financial and reputational damage.

The risk intensifies when employees misuse login privileges or access customer data without proper authorization. Fraudulent activities such as theft of confidential data, manipulation of financial records, or leaking information can occur with insider involvement.

Banks must implement strict controls to detect and prevent insider threats, including role-based access, segregation of duties, and regular monitoring of internal activities. Establishing a robust audit trail helps trace suspicious actions back to responsible individuals.

Legal provisions under banking law increasingly emphasize the importance of internal controls and accountability to combat insider threats, reinforcing the need for comprehensive policies, ongoing employee training, and reporting mechanisms to ensure data security.

Technology Solutions Enhancing Data Security in Banking

Technological solutions significantly bolster data security in banking by employing advanced tools and methodologies. Encrypted communication channels, such as SSL/TLS protocols, protect sensitive data during transmission, reducing the risk of interception by malicious actors.

Secure access controls, multi-factor authentication, and biometric verification ensure that only authorized personnel can access confidential information, preventing unauthorized intrusion. These measures create multiple barriers, making data breaches more difficult to execute.

Furthermore, deploying intrusion detection systems (IDS) and intrusion prevention systems (IPS) allows banks to monitor real-time network activity, identifying potential threats before they cause harm. Regular system updates and patch management are also vital to address vulnerabilities exploited by cybercriminals.

While these technological solutions are effective, they must be complemented by strong policies and employee training. An integrated approach, combining innovative tools with legal compliance, optimizes data security in banking and aligns with the evolving landscape of banking law.

Regular Security Audits and Vulnerability Assessments

Regular security audits and vulnerability assessments are fundamental practices in maintaining robust data security in banking. These evaluations systematically examine the banking systems and networks to identify potential weaknesses.

They involve comprehensive testing of hardware, software, and network configurations to ensure compliance with established security policies. Regular inspections help detect vulnerabilities that cybercriminals could exploit, minimizing security risks.

Vulnerability assessments prioritize the identified threats based on their potential impact and likelihood, allowing banks to address the most critical issues proactively. These procedures are vital in aligning security measures with evolving threats and regulatory requirements under banking law.

Consistent application of security audits and assessments enhances the bank’s ability to safeguard sensitive customer data, fortify defenses, and uphold trust. Incorporating these practices into a bank’s security strategy is an essential component of overall data security in banking.
